On this tour you will learn about all the history and flavors that represent the province of Puerto Plata, how they live and to which the locals are dedicated such as schools, universities and public transport, as well as you will be entertained to taste the types of rum and a delicious dessert in the chocolate factory. We will visit the pink street, a walk in the parasol street, a cigar factory to see how the cigars are made, the museum of amber and barley. The central park surrounded by the old Victorian houses, the cathedral San Felipe with its beautiful architecture. we will stop at the sea wall to appreciate the beautiful view of the Atlantic sea where the rock of Neptune is. Its foundation dates from 1502, but due to the fire caused by the restorers in 1863 it was completely destroyed. And it wasn’t until 1956 that it was completely restored, although in 2008 it was remodeled. The cathedral has great religious value for Dominicans and is one of the most important pilgrimage points in the whole Dominican Republic.
Its history dates back to 1898 when Isidoro Rainieri and Bianca Franceschini, natives of Italy, arrived in Puerto Plata and realizing that a hotel was needed to serve travelers decided to found the Lodging of Commerce, to which they later changed the name to Hotel Europa.
